IACURH
Student leaders from Alberta, Montana, Idaho, Wyoming, Utah, Colorado, New Mexico and Arizona gather together at a university within the intermountain west for a weekend conference. IACURH 2009 will be held at Northern Arizona University in Flagstaff, AZ in from November 12-15, 2009. No Frills
The annual business conference for all schools within the IACURH region. Three representatives from each school (NCC, NRHH President and RHA President) are asked to attend this conference and serve as the voice for all on-campus residents at their host institution. This conference is hosted annually by University's within IACURH and bids to host the conference are presented each year at the regional conference. Also, all national award bid nominees are determined during No Frills
NACURH
NACURH is the largest student run, non-profit organization in the country. While the largest annual meeting, the NACURH conference, can draw thousands of delegates to a single convention, the roots of NACURH are in each individual school’s Residence Hall Association. NACURH released a vision statement that acknowledged on campus living as an opportunity for students to directly effect their community for the better, and for leaders to take the necessary steps to make campus the ultimate place to live, learn, and have fun. This conference is held annually during the summer semester and could be located anywhere in the country. NACURH 2010 will be hosted at the University of San Diego
